URC Langenlois Athlete Dagmar Pathenhauer Qualifies for Ironman World Championships: Aloha Hawaii

For URC Langenlois athlete Dagmar Pathenhauer it’s “Aloha Hawaii” after the successful qualification for the Ironman World Championships.

DAgmar Pathenhauer and Manuela Kanzler competed in the Ironman in Kalmar and qualified for the World Championships in October.

With Dagmar Pathenhauer and Manuela Kanzler, two athletes from the URC Langenlois competed in the tenth edition of the Ironman Sweden in Kalmar. The competition is known for its flat and fast running and cycling routes. The weather showed its rough side on the day of the Ironman. Strong wind and fog made it difficult to complete the 3.8-kilometer swim in the Baltic Sea. At the end of the first discipline, Chancellor and Pathenhauer were almost level.

The total of 180 kilometers on the bike was largely completed on Öland, the rest on the mainland around Kalmar. The highlight is the six kilometer long bridge to Öland, which is otherwise closed to cyclists. The second discipline also proved to be a real challenge due to the gusts of wind, Kanzler coped better with it and switched to running shoes before Pathenhauer. In the final marathon, the latter was in the lead and finished in just over 12 hours, while Kanzler crossed the finish line in a little less than twelve and a half hours. With the results, both athletes managed to get a coveted slot for the Ironman World Championships in Hawaii in October. While Chancellor declined with thanks, Pathenhauer happily accepted the qualifying spot.
